Output 16263f625ddffb8d2c244c266b5162c2965e70b33173d1374b12b35cb652fbd4:1

value
668611945
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3dd3e34a52fa1ef1841b5ac87505aee6590b03a OP_EQUALVERIFY OP_CHECKSIG
address
1LKEci77PKNySPcpgWnhHQ31XndYsuZneR
transaction
16263f625ddffb8d2c244c266b5162c2965e70b33173d1374b12b35cb652fbd4
spent
true